Hi, I'm Gabriel A. Devenyi (@gdevenyi)

🧠 Research Computing Associate β€” Cerebral Imaging Centre, Douglas Mental Health University Institute, McGill University πŸ”¬ Neuroimaging Infrastructure β€’ Reproducible Pipelines β€’ Research HPC πŸ“ MontrΓ©al, QuΓ©bec, Canada Β· @CoBrALab Β· @DouglasNeuroInformatics


🌍 About Me

I build and maintain the computational backbone of a neuroimaging research lab β€” turning messy multi-modal brain-imaging data into reproducible, automated, and scalable analysis. My work sits at the intersection of systems administration, scientific software engineering, and high-performance computing, so researchers spend time on science instead of fighting their tools.

  • πŸ”­ Building reproducible neuroimaging pipelines and the HPC/workstation infra behind them
  • 🌱 Currently working on local LLM inference and GGUF sizing tooling
  • πŸ‘― Open to collaborating on open, FAIR, reproducible research software
  • πŸ’¬ Ask me about neuroimaging pipelines, Ansible, containers, or Slurm

🧩 Open Source Work

Most of my open-source work ships through the two labs I build infrastructure for:

🧠 CoBrA Lab β€” neuroimaging pipelines & atlases

Repository Focus Highlights
RABIES Rodent fMRI Preprocessing + analysis pipeline for rodent imaging (61β˜…)
MAGeTbrain Segmentation Multiple Automatically Generated Templates brain segmentation (50β˜…)
optimized_antsMultivariateTemplateConstruction Template building Optimized ANTs template construction with qbatch support (40β˜…)
atlases Neuroanatomy Hi-res T1/T2 segmentations + MNI population averages (38β˜…)
qbatch HPC Batch execution of command lists on Slurm/PBS clusters (34β˜…)

🧬 Douglas Neuroinformatics β€” clinical data platforms

Repository Focus Highlights
OpenDataCapture Clinical EDC Electronic data capture for remote & in-person instruments (118β˜…) β€” opendatacapture.org
DataBank Data sharing Web platform for managing, versioning & sharing tabular datasets
ansible-playbooks Infrastructure Ansible provisioning for CIC workstations & servers
